    Kindly press Windows key + R

    Type: control panel.

    Hit enter

    On the control panel Window click hardware and sound.

    Click on Power Options.

    Click on Choose what closing the lid does.

    On the section of When I closes the lid - set it to sleep.

    If it is already set to sleep, change it on different settings then save settings.

    Restart the computer then go to the same settings again then change it back to sleep again.

    Restart the computer one more time and check if issue persists.
